Awe-Inspiring Singapore: 5-Day Itinerary

Friday, November 3: Exploring the Iconic Singapore Marina Bay

Start your trip in Singapore by immersing yourself in the captivating atmosphere of Marina Bay. In the morning, take a leisurely stroll along the picturesque Singapore River, admiring the cityscape and historic landmarks. In the afternoon, visit the iconic Marina Bay Sands complex and marvel at its stunning architecture. Ascend to the dazzling rooftop SkyPark for panoramic views of the city. As the evening sets in, head to Gardens by the Bay to witness the mesmerizing Supertree light show.

  • Singapore River: No cost, 2-3 hours
  • Marina Bay Sands: No cost for exterior viewing, 2-3 hours
  • Gardens by the Bay: No cost for outdoor gardens, $8-28 for indoor attractions, 2-3 hours
Saturday, November 4: Exploring Cultural Heritage in Chinatown

Immerse yourself in the vibrant cultural heritage of Singapore's Chinatown. Start your morning by exploring the colorful streets and visiting the elaborate Buddha Tooth Relic Temple. In the afternoon, dive into the gastronomic delights of Chinatown Food Street, where you can sample various local delicacies. In the evening, soak in the lively atmosphere of the night market along Pagoda Street, offering unique souvenirs and trinkets.

  • Buddha Tooth Relic Temple: No cost, 1-2 hours
  • Chinatown Food Street: Prices vary depending on food choices, 2-3 hours
  • Pagoda Street Night Market: No cost, 1-2 hours
Sunday, November 5: Sentosa Island Adventure

Escape to the tropical paradise of Sentosa Island for a day filled with excitement. Start your morning with a visit to Universal Studios, where you can experience thrilling rides and immerse yourself in movie magic. In the afternoon, relax at one of the pristine beaches or dive into the crystal-clear waters for some snorkeling. As the evening approaches, catch the stunning Wings of Time show, a mesmerizing display of lights, water, and fireworks.

  • Universal Studios: Prices start from $81, 6-8 hours
  • Sentosa Beaches: No cost, 2-3 hours
  • Wings of Time: Prices start from $18, 1 hour
Monday, November 6: Exploring Nature at Singapore Botanic Gardens

Discover the natural beauty of Singapore at the enchanting Botanic Gardens. Begin your morning with a peaceful walk through the National Orchid Garden, featuring a vast collection of stunning orchids. In the afternoon, explore the rest of the Botanic Gardens, including the serene lakes, lush foliage, and the Orchid Plaza. End your day with a visit to the nearby National Museum of Singapore for a glimpse into the country's rich history and culture.

  • National Orchid Garden: $5, 2-3 hours
  • Singapore Botanic Gardens: No cost, 2-3 hours
  • National Museum of Singapore: $15, 2-3 hours
Tuesday, November 7: Meandering through the Singapore Zoo

Embark on a wildlife adventure at the renowned Singapore Zoo. In the morning, explore the diverse habitats and encounter fascinating animals from around the world. Don't miss the opportunity to have breakfast with orangutans for a truly unforgettable experience. In the afternoon, visit the nearby River Safari to observe various river ecosystems. As your day comes to an end, enjoy a tranquil boat ride along the Upper Seletar Reservoir.

  • Singapore Zoo: Prices start from $39, 5-6 hours
  • River Safari: Prices start from $33, 3-4 hours
  • Upper Seletar Reservoir: No cost, 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

When exploring Singapore, be sure to visit Tiong Bahru, a hip neighborhood known for its quaint cafes and unique shops housed in art deco buildings. Discover the Kampong Glam district, home to the impressive Sultan Mosque and vibrant Arab Street, filled with traditional clothing stores and Middle Eastern eateries. Lastly, explore the bustling streets of Little India, where you can savor aromatic spices, explore colorful temples, and experience the lively atmosphere of this vibrant cultural enclave.
